Harnessing your creative visions often requires gaining the right assets. When it comes to visual elements, understanding the disparities between royalty-free and rights-managed licenses is essential.
Royalty-free licenses offer versatility, allowing you to employ the asset for a broad range of purposes without ongoing fees. This makes them ideal for professional projects where cost-effectiveness is essential.
Conversely, rights-managed licenses offer more restriction over the deployment of the work. These licenses often specify constraints on how the content can be used, such as the amount of occurrences it can be distributed, the region where it can be applied, and the specific goal.
Rights-managed licenses are often preferred for premium projects where intellectual property rights are critical.

Navigating Art Licensing: A Guide to Rights-Managed Agreements
When it comes in regards to art licensing, grasping rights-managed agreements is crucial. These agreements grant specific licenses for the use of an artwork in a defined manner. Generally, rights-managed licenses are non-exclusive, meaning the licensor (the artist or their representative) can remain capable of grant similar permissions to others. This is in contrast with royalty-free licenses, which allow for unrestricted use.
To effectively navigate rights-managed agreements, you should evaluate factors such as the intended application of the artwork, the duration of the license, and the territory in which it will be used. Moreover, the agreement should clearly define the scope of permissions granted, any restrictions on modifications or alterations, and compensation terms. Seeking a legal professional experienced in art licensing can provide invaluable guidance and ensure that your rights are maintained.
